Fine Street adds control title to its portfolio
Monday, January 28th, 2013Fine Street has added Control Engineering Russia to it’s portfolio, a great move that complements it’s existing publications, including Components and Technologies.

Quantum ceases publication with immediate effect
Wednesday, January 23rd, 2013Sad to hear that Crown Publications has decided to close Quantum after 18 years. Crown have decided to walk away from the electronics industry completely, closing both the print edition and the website with “immediate effect”, although they plan to continue their electrical industry titles.
